Maryland basketball is back home, facing off against Iowa at 8 p.m. on FS1.The Terps get a pitstop at home before two more on the road.

Maryland is 2-2 in league play after a sobering blowout to No. 1 Michigan State, the Terps get a shot to bounce back. This is the only time these two teams will match up this season. The Hawkeyes are still winless in Big Ten play through four games, with January losses to Michigan and Ohio State. Iowa head coach Fran McCaffery is still adjusting to life without Peter Jok, and Iowa has yet to put it together. Sophomore Tyler Cook is the Hawkeyes' leading scorer and rebounder, averaging 15.2 points and 6.6 rebounds a night.
